BROADWAY, NEW YORK 2008FAQ SHEET
“Wicked”
Age Limit & Requirements:
- Students/Children must be at least 5 to be able to go on the trip with or without a parent chaperone.
- Parents/Guardians will be required to register and accompany children between the ages of 5-9 to act as their chaperone.
- Students/Children 10 and older may register for the trip without a parent or guardian registering or participating. These students will be placed under the care of a chaperone.
- Disclaimer: “Wicked” may not be appropriate for children ages 8 or younger.
47 Guaranteed Spaces:
The first 47 to register will be guaranteed a space on the trip. We will initially reserve one bus for the trip that will accommodate 47 registrants, the staff, and our tour guide. Registrations received beyond our 47 limit will be placed on hold until we can completely fill another bus seating a minimum of 40 additional registrants. If we are not able to meet this quota, all registration fees and deposits paid in advance will be returned to those not within the first 47.
Completing The Registration Form:
1 Registration Form may be completed per family or per account. For example, if a studio student is registering along with Mom, Dad, and brother John, then we would assume you will be paying all together and therefore you will only need to complete 1 Registration Form. If, however, you have invited 2 cousins and 2 neighborhood friends who will be paying their own bill, then each family would need to complete their own Registration Form.

Refunds:
- 50% of all deposits paid in advance will be refunded if cancellation occurs by November 30th, 2008
- No refunds will be given for cancellations after November 30th, 2008
- Registrants will receive a 100% refund of all fees paid if the trip is cancelled for any reason.
Chaperones & Ratios:
- Parent Chaperones are needed and required for our trip to Broadway. We encourage as many parents as possible to accompany their children and/or consider being a chaperone.
- Chaperones must be at least 18 years old.
- Chaperones will be required to pay for their own trip unless otherwise arranged.
- We must have men as well as women act as chaperones.
- We must have a minimum ratio of 1 Chaperone per 4 children.
- Parents who register with their children will automatically act as their Chaperone and may have other children placed in their group in order to meet ratio requirements.
Room Assignments:
- Registrants will have the option of selecting their roommates or we may do this for you. For example, if you are a family of 4 (2 Parents and 2 children) you may wish to save money and select a Quad Room so you all can stay together or you might prefer to reserve 1 Double Room for the parents and 1 double room for the 2 children. The choice is up to you!
- Registrants may also select other registrants to be roommates if desired. For example, if two sisters are registered for the trip without the parents and they wish to pay for a Quad Room, they may select two other registered friends as roommates. We suggest you discuss and arrange this with the other parties involved before completing your Registration Forms so all parties are agreed.
- We will select roommates for those who have not indicated a preference but desire multiple guest rooms.
- If we are not able to find suitable roommates for single registrants who have requested multiple guests rooms, registrants will be responsible to pay the adjusted additional amount for their trip. Please try to arrange your roommates in advance.
- Boys and girls must stay in separate rooms unless they are siblings or family members.
Lights Out:
- All students/children will be required to be in their hotel rooms by 11:00PM if not accompanied by an adult/guardian. Chaperones will be enforcing this curfew.
